Hf₂V₄H₈ is a metal hydride compound belonging to the transition metal hydride family, combining hafnium and vanadium with hydrogen incorporation. This material is primarily of research and developmental interest rather than established in commercial production, with potential applications in hydrogen storage, advanced ceramics, and functional materials where metal hydrides offer unique electronic or structural properties. The combination of hafnium and vanadium suggests potential for high-temperature stability and interesting electrochemical characteristics compared to conventional hydrides.
